During the first-quarter earnings call, management emphasized robust execution against a challenging macroeconomic backdrop, highlighting a 15% year-over-year increase in the number of customers contributing more than $10,000 in annual recurring revenue. Operational efficiency remained a central theme, with the company delivering adjusted earnings per share of $0.23—a result that exceeded consensus expectations. Key business drivers cited included the ongoing adoption of the unified platform, particularly the recently enhanced AI-powered listening and workflow automation features, which management noted are helping clients consolidate point solutions and streamline social media management. The leadership team also pointed to strong retention rates and an expanding presence within the enterprise segment as evidence of the platform's deepening strategic value. On the operational front, Sprout Social made notable progress in scaling its sales organization and investing in customer success initiatives, which management believes will support sustained momentum through the remainder of the year. While near-term macroeconomic uncertainty persists, the company expressed confidence in its ability to capture additional market share by focusing on product innovation and customer outcomes.
Sprout Social’s first-quarter results surpassed market expectations, and management used the earnings call to outline a measured but optimistic outlook for the coming quarters. The company noted that enterprise customer momentum remains strong, with larger deal cycles closing at a steady pace, though it acknowledged that macroeconomic conditions could temper the speed of expansion in some segments. For the second quarter, Sprout Social anticipates revenue growth to continue in the high teens on a year-over-year basis, supported by further adoption of its AI-powered analytics tools and deeper integrations with social platforms. The guidance reflects management’s confidence in its product roadmap, particularly the recently launched features for content optimization and cross-platform reporting, which are expected to drive higher average revenue per user. At the same time, executives pointed to ongoing investments in sales and marketing to capture new logo growth in the mid-market, where competition remains elevated. The full-year outlook implies a gradual margin improvement as operating leverage improves, with adjusted EPS anticipated to expand modestly above the first-quarter pace. While the company does not guarantee specific milestones, its forward-looking statements signal a belief that product differentiation and a growing total addressable market will underpin sustainable growth. Investors should monitor renewal rates and customer churn trends as key indicators of whether these expectations materialize.
Sprout Social’s Q1 2026 results landed with an adjusted EPS of $0.23, topping consensus expectations. While revenue figures were not disclosed in the preliminary release, the earnings beat provided a catalyst for a notable upward move in the stock during the following trading sessions. The market’s reaction appears to reflect renewed confidence in the company’s ability to manage costs and improve profitability, even as top-line growth remains under scrutiny.
Analysts have responded with measured optimism. Several firms raised their price targets following the print, citing the potential for sustained margin expansion as the company scales its customer base. However, caution remains prevalent: lingering macroeconomic headwinds and competitive pressures in the social media management space continue to temper enthusiasm. No explicit buy or sell recommendations were issued, but the tone of recent notes suggests that the EPS surprise could support a valuation floor in the near term.
From a stock price perspective, SPT shares traded higher on elevated volume in the days after the release, with relative strength indicators moving into neutral territory—avoiding overbought signals. The move suggests that investors are pricing in a more favorable risk/reward profile for the current environment. That said, the absence of detailed revenue guidance leaves the narrative incomplete, and further clarity would likely be needed to sustain upward momentum in the coming weeks.
